发明名称 Image correction apparatus, image correction method, and biometric authentication apparatus
摘要 An image correction apparatus includes a correction factor calculating unit which calculates a correction factor such that a distance between a corrected value obtained by correcting, using the correction factor, a luminance value of a first pixel on the image corresponding to a sensor element with a first filter in an image sensor included in an image capturing unit which generates the image, the first filter having a first transmittance characteristic and a luminance value of a second pixel on the image corresponding to a sensor element with a second filter in the image sensor, the second filter having a second transmittance characteristic, becomes smaller than a distance between the luminance value of the first pixel and the luminance value of the second pixel, and a correcting unit which generates a corrected image by correcting the luminance value of the first pixel using the correction factor.

主权项 1. An image correction apparatus comprising: a processor configured to: calculate a correction factor such that a distance between a corrected value obtained by correcting, using the correction factor, a luminance value of a first pixel on an image corresponding to a sensor element with a first filter in an image sensor included in an image capturing device which generates the image, the first filter having a first transmittance characteristic, and a luminance value of a second pixel on the image corresponding to a sensor element with a second filter in the image sensor, the second filter having a second transmittance characteristic different from the first transmittance characteristic, becomes smaller than a distance between the luminance value of the first pixel and the luminance value of the second pixel; and generate a corrected image by correcting the luminance value of the first pixel using the correction factor, wherein the calculation of the correction factor calculates the correction factor which is common to each first pixel of a plurality of sets of the first pixel and the second pixel according to a relational equation between the luminance values of the first pixel and the second pixel, such that a total sum of differences between the corrected value and the luminance value of the second pixel in each of the plurality of sets is decreased, the first pixel and the second pixel in each of the plurality of sets being placed in a certain positional relationship.
